M33 NSKK Service Dagger


Description

This Helbig produced NSKK dagger has all of the normal characteristics we see with this producer. The Helbig daggers were the only examples to be equipped with steel cross-guards having chromed surfaces. The same was true of the scabbard mounts. The steel cross-guards were only produced by the Helbig firm.

The cross-guards, despite their chrome finish, have just a little corrosion and is hardly disturbing the overall piece.

The grip is a fine mahogany type and it shows some usage but is still in good condition with a minor crack at the reverse top. The SA runes button is nicely placed. The enamel is still in excellent condition. The nickel grip eagle is the style with "beak pointing upwards slightly". This eagle shows only modest wear to the surfaces but the beak, eye, breast feathering, wing feathering, talons, wreath and mobile swastika are still in good condition. It is also interesting to note that the grip eagles on Helbig daggers are placed higher on the grip than the norm. As we know grip eagles were to be placed just below the center line of the bulbous portion of the grip, not in the center.

The scabbard shell is straight throughout. This shell has good black paint showing a few scratches here and there but it still has its original brightness and rates at about 98%. The chrome plated scabbard mounts are in excellent condition to include the lower ball. These mounts also have matching patination. The mounts are secured by dome head steel screws which are unturned. The blade of this example remains in a bright condition. As is typical of the Helbig firm the etching to the SA motto is extremely light. Despite this the motto still remains quite clear. The reverse of the blade is matching lightly etched with a double RZM circle having a shaded center. Below the circle is the code, "M 7/70". It is also interesting to note that the shoulder to cross-guard contour fit is not very good but again this is yet another Helbig trait.

Comes with black belt hanger and the actual hanger itself marked RZM M 5/71 OLC.
